Accelerate Your Site Performance: Advanced Loading Strategies
In today's fast-paced digital world, website speed is paramount. Customers expect lightning-fast loading times, and anything slower can result in lost traffic and diminished conversions. To stay ahead of the curve, you need to implement cutting-edge loading techniques that will maximize your site's performance. This involves a multi-pronged approach, from exploiting browser caching to compressing image sizes and fine-tuning code for swift execution. By embracing these strategies, you can guarantee a seamless user experience that keeps visitors engaged and coming back for more.
Additionally, consider integrating content delivery networks (CDNs) to distribute your website's content across multiple servers worldwide. This geographically-based approach reduces latency, ensuring users receive content from the server closest to them, leading to faster loading times and improved performance.
- Employ browser caching to store frequently accessed files on user devices, reducing the need for repeated downloads.
- Compress image sizes without sacrificing quality to minimize file transfer speeds.
- Fine-tune your website's code by eliminating unnecessary elements and improving its structure for efficient execution.
- Consider the benefits of a content delivery network (CDN) to distribute your content globally and reduce latency.
By integrating these cutting-edge loading techniques, you can drastically improve your website's speed and deliver a superior user experience that keeps visitors coming back for more. Remember, in the digital landscape, a fast website is not just a luxury—it's a necessity.
Edge Computing: Boosting Web App Speed
As web applications evolve in complexity and demand, developers are constantly seeking ways to enhance performance. Enter edge computing, a paradigm shift that's radically altering the landscape of web development. By bringing computation and data storage closer to users, edge computing reduces latency issues, resulting in lightning-fast load times and an overall enhanced user experience.
- Previously, web applications relied on centralized data centers, often located thousands of miles away from users. This distance inevitably led to delays in data transmission, causing sluggish performance and frustrating user experiences.
- Edge computing challenges this traditional model by distributing processing power and data storage across a network of edge servers located at the perimeter of the internet.
- This decentralized approach allows applications to handle requests closer to users, eliminating latency and providing a seamless and responsive experience.
The benefits of edge computing for web development are manifold. Developers can exploit this technology to create highly performant applications that excel in demanding environments.

The Edge Effect Faster, More Responsive Web Experiences
In today's fast-paced digital world, users expect rapid web experiences. To meet these demands, developers are increasingly turning to edge computing as a solution. Edge computing brings computation and data storage closer to the end user, reducing latency and enhancing overall performance. By processing data at the edge, instead of relying on centralized servers, applications can become dramatically faster and more responsive.
This distributed approach to computing offers a number of perks. For example, edge computing can minimize latency for time-sensitive applications like online gaming and video conferencing. It can also improve user experience by minimizing page load times and enabling faster content delivery.
- Additionally, edge computing can help to offload traffic from centralized servers, improving their efficiency and scalability.
- Ultimately, the edge effect offers a powerful way to boost web performance and deliver a more seamless user experience.
